第1章8086系统结构ppt2007.pptx

  1. 1、本文档共145页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
第1章8086系统结构ppt2007

通过本章学习,应掌握以下内容: 8086CPU结构 CPU引脚及其功能 存储器组织与堆栈 8086系统配置 ;§1.1 8086CPU结构 一、 8086的功能结构 微处理器 8086从功能上分为两部分:总线接口部分(BIU),执行部分(EU)。 两部分各自执行自己的功能并行工作,这种工作方式与传统的 计算机在执行指令时的串行工作方式相比极大地提高了工作效率。 ;传统的CPU采用串行工作方式:;8086CPU并行工作方式:;;1、总线接口部件(BIU) 功能: (1)从内存取指令送到指令队列。 (2)CPU执行指令时,到指定的位置取操作数,并将其送至要求的位置单元中。 总线接口部件的组成: (1)四个段地址寄存器 CS,16位代码段寄存器; DS,16位数据段寄存器; ES,16位附加段寄存器; SS,16位堆栈段寄存器。;(2)16位指令指针寄存器IP(PC)。 (3)20位的地址加法器。 (4)六字节的指令队列缓冲器。 说明: (1)指令队列缓冲器:在执行指令的同时,将取下一条指令,并放入指令队列缓冲器中。CPU执行完一条指令后,可以执行下一条指令(流水线技术)。提高CPU效率。 (2)地址加法器:产生20位地址。CPU内无论是段地址寄存器还是偏移量都是16位的,通过地址加法器产生20位地址。;2、执行部件 作用: (1)从指令队列中取出指令。 (2)对指令进行译码,发出相应的控制信号。 (3)接收由总线接口送来的数据或发送数据至接口。 (4)进行算术运算。 执行部件的组成: (1)4个通用寄存器AX、BX、CX、DX。 四个通用寄存器都是16位或作两个8位来使用。 (2)4个专用寄存器;SP------堆栈指针寄存器 BP------基址指针寄存器 DI-------目的变址寄存器 SI------- 源变址寄存器 (3)算术逻辑单元ALU 完成8位或者16位二进制算术和逻辑运算,计算偏移量。 (4)数据暂存寄存器 协助ALU完成运算,暂存参加运算的数据。 (5)执行部件的控制电路 从总线接口的指令队列取出指令操作码,通过译码电路分析,发出相应的控制命令,控制ALU数据流向。;(6)标志寄存器 16位寄存器,其中有7位未用。;3、CPU执行程序的操作过程 (1)20位地址形成,并将从该地址指定的单元中取出指令字节,依次放入指令队列中。 (2)当指令队列中有2个空字节时,总线接口部件就会自动取指令至队列中。 (3)执行部件从指令队列队首取出指令代码,执行该指令。 (4)当队列已满,执行部件又不使用总线时,总线接口部件进入空闲状态。 (5)执行转移指令、调用指令、返回指令时,先清空队列内容,再将要执行的指令放入队列中。;§1.2 8086CPU的引脚及其功能 8086CPU可在两种模式下工作: 最小模式:只有一8086CPU。 最大模式:有两个或两个以上的CPU,一个为主CPU8086,另一个为协CPU8087。 指令周期:执行一条指令所需要的时间。 总线周期(机器周期):CPU通过总线与存储器或I/O接口进行一次数据传输所需的时间。 T状态(时钟周期):CPU处理动作的最小单位。;;引脚及功能 1、地址/数据总线 AD15-AD0:地址/数据复用引脚,双向,三态。 在T1状态,为16位地址总线A15-A0,输出访问存储器或I/O的地址信息。 在T2~T4状态,为16位数据总线D15-D0,与存储器和I/O设备交换数据信息。 地址/数据总线复用,分时工作。;T1状态:输出地址的高4位信息A19-A16 T2、T3、T4状态:输出状态信息 S6:指示当前CPU是否与总线相连,S6=0,表示8086当前与总线相连。 S5:中断允许标志当前的状态。 S5=0,禁止一切可屏蔽中断源的中断请求; S5=1,允许一切可屏蔽中断源的中断申请。;S4、S3:当前正在使用的段寄存器 S4 S3 段寄存器 0 0 当前正在使用ES 0 1 当前正在使用SS 1 0 当前正在使用CS 1 1 当前正在使

您可能关注的文档

文档评论(0)

xcs88858 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:8130065136000003

1亿VIP精品文档

相关文档